采用劈嵴技术的上颌牙槽嵴扩展与自体骨块移植的侧方嵴增高术的比较:一项系统评价

Maxillary Alveolar Ridge Expansion with Split-Crest Technique Compared with Lateral Ridge Augmentation with Autogenous Bone Block Graft: a Systematic Review.

作者信息

Starch-Jensen Thomas, Becktor Jonas Peter

机构信息

Department of Oral and Maxillofacial Surgery, Aalborg University Hospital, AalborgDenmark.

Department of Oral and Maxillofacial Surgery and Oral Medicine, Malmö University, MalmöSweden.

出版信息

J Oral Maxillofac Res. 2019 Dec 30;10(4):e2. doi: 10.5037/jomr.2019.10402. eCollection 2019 Oct-Dec.

DOI:10.5037/jomr.2019.10402
PMID:32158526
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C7012616/
Abstract

OBJECTIVES

The objective of the present systematic review was to test the hypothesis of no difference in implant treatment outcome after maxillary alveolar ridge expansion with split-crest technique compared with lateral ridge augmentation with autogenous bone block graft.

MATERIAL AND METHODS

A MEDLINE (PubMed), Embase and Cochrane Library search in combination with a hand-search of relevant journals was conducted. Human studies published in English until 8th of February, 2018 were included.

RESULTS

One comparative and four noncomparative studies fulfilled the inclusion criteria. Both treatment modalities disclosed high survival rate of implants with few complications. High survival rate of prosthesis, implant stability values, limited peri-implant marginal bone loss and gain in maxillary alveolar ridge width were reported with the split-crest technique. Patient-reported outcome measure and length of patient treatment time was not assessed in any of the included studies.

CONCLUSIONS

The split-crest technique seems to be useful for horizontal augmentation of maxillary alveolar deficiencies with high survival rate of prosthesis and implants. However, further long-term randomized controlled trials with larger patient sample as well as assessment of patient-reported outcome measures and patient treatment time are needed before well-defined conclusions can be provided about the two treatment modalities.

摘要

目的

本系统评价的目的是检验与采用自体骨块移植进行侧方牙槽嵴增高术相比,采用分嵴技术进行上颌牙槽嵴扩展后种植治疗效果无差异这一假设。

材料与方法

对MEDLINE(PubMed)、Embase和Cochrane图书馆进行检索,并结合手工检索相关期刊。纳入截至2018年2月8日发表的英文人体研究。

结果

一项比较研究和四项非比较研究符合纳入标准。两种治疗方式均显示种植体存活率高,并发症少。分嵴技术报告了较高的义齿存活率、种植体稳定性值、种植体周围边缘骨丢失有限以及上颌牙槽嵴宽度增加。纳入的任何研究均未评估患者报告的结局指标和患者治疗时间。

结论

分嵴技术似乎对上颌牙槽嵴缺损的水平增高有效,义齿和种植体存活率高。然而,在能够对这两种治疗方式得出明确结论之前,需要进一步开展更大样本量的长期随机对照试验,并评估患者报告的结局指标和患者治疗时间。
